Output 63d6fba3ae0e98199362c9a369e71caa039cf10bdbf7abd362920ad051e29b5b:20

value
23151
script pubkey
OP_0 OP_PUSHBYTES_20 d3c97bf1a2d1461325233ca6ac2647ddf279be5e
address
bc1q60yhhudz69rpxffr8jn2cfj8mhe8n0j78ansvt
transaction
63d6fba3ae0e98199362c9a369e71caa039cf10bdbf7abd362920ad051e29b5b